There's just no way the committee and staff can run a convention without the help of the convention membership. As always, Loscon needs your help, before, during and after the convention to keep things running smoothly.
Volunteering at Loscon has its rewards. One of them is learning more about the convention, and how conventions get put together and run. Not only do you have the satisfaction of knowing you've helped make the convention a success, there will be the traditional spiffs, only available to volunteers. In keeping with the convention's theme, they will be travel related and at least one will be both valuable and imported.
The number of hours required for a Pass-on Membership cannot be reported at this time, it is based on total Convention Membership and thus can only be calculated Post-Con.
Extra Credit Hours:
Pre-con and Post-con work (like loading or unloading the truck) counts DOUBLE toward pass-on membership hours. (Note: pre-con and post-con hours are not doubled toward spiffs, just toward pass-on memberships)
Check with the Volunteers coordinator when you arrive at the convention, or be sure to find out who is tracking pre-con and post-con hours if you help out before and/or after the convention. Volunteers will be located at the Information kiosk (see Hotel Layout Page for location details).
